Blockchain

Binary Fields and also SNARKs: Checking Out Cryptographic Efficiency

.Rebeca Moen.Sep 25, 2024 05:04.This short article explores the duty of binary areas in SNARKs, highlighting their productivity in cryptographic procedures as well as possible future improvements.
Binary areas have actually long been actually a cornerstone in cryptography, offering dependable procedures for electronic systems. Their importance has actually expanded along with the progression of SNARKs (Blunt Non-Interactive Arguments of Know-how), which take advantage of areas for complicated estimates and also verifications. Depending on to taiko.mirror.xyz, current styles pay attention to minimizing the industry dimension in SNARKs to improve productivity, using constructs like Mersenne Excellent fields.Recognizing Fields in Cryptography.In cryptography, fields are mathematical constructs that enable general calculation procedures-- enhancement, reduction, multiplication, and division-- within a collection of varieties, sticking to specific guidelines like commutativity, associativity, as well as the presence of neutral elements and inverses. The most basic area made use of in cryptography is actually GF( 2) or F2, consisting of merely pair of factors: 0 as well as 1.The Significance of Fields.Area are critical for conducting arithmetic procedures that create cryptographic tricks. While boundless areas are achievable, computers run within limited industries for productivity, commonly using 2 ^ 64-bit areas. Smaller sized areas are liked for their efficient math, aligning with our mental versions that favor convenient portions of records.The SNARKs Garden.SNARKs validate the accuracy of sophisticated arithmetics along with very little information, creating them ideal for resource-constrained atmospheres. There are 2 main kinds of SNARKs:.Elliptic Contour Located: Recognized for very small verifications and also constant-time verification however might require a trusted setup and also are actually slower to produce proofs.Hash-Based (STARKs): Rely on hash features for safety, have much larger verifications, and are actually slower to confirm yet faster to verify.SNARKs Performance Difficulties.Performance traffic jams in SNARK functions usually emerge throughout the dedication period, which includes making a cryptographic dedication to the witness data. Binius addresses this issue utilizing binary industries as well as arithmetization-friendly hash functions like Grostl, although it introduces new challenges in the fading away debate stage.SNARKs Over the Smallest Industry.The present pattern in cryptographic research study is to lessen industry sizes to minimize embedding cost. Initiatives like Circle STARKs and also Starkware's Stwo prover now make use of Mersenne Prime industries for better CPU optimization. This technique straightens with the all-natural human possibility to operate smaller, even more reliable industries.Binary Specialization in Cryptography.Binary fields, denoted as F( 2 ^ n), are actually limited ranges along with 2 ^ n elements. They are basic in digital bodies for encoding, handling, and also broadcasting data. Building SNARKs over binary industries is an unfamiliar method introduced through Irreducible, leveraging the simpleness and performance of binary math.Developing a High Rise of Binary Area.Beginning with the most basic binary field F2, much larger areas are actually created by launching brand-new components, developing a tower of areas: F2, F2 ^ 2, F2 ^ 4, and so forth. This construct enables reliable math procedures all over different area sizes, harmonizing safety needs with computational performance in cryptographic applications.Potential of Binary Area.Binary industries have been actually essential to cryptography for a long time, yet their application in property SNARKs is actually a current as well as encouraging advancement. As research study progresses, binary field-based verification strategies are actually counted on to observe notable enhancements, straightening with the vital individual desire in the direction of simpleness and also efficiency.Image source: Shutterstock.